Most immigrants in Bengaluru just learn two words - Kannada gothilla: Kirik Keerthi 2018-04-10T14:36:08.703Z He’s a popular social commentator online and his stint on Bigg Boss Kannada made him a household name. Kirik Keerthi recently dropped by at the Bangalore Times office for a chat. Excerpts... On getting the ‘kirik’ tag This tag is not because of the kirik (mischief) I do in life. In 2012, when I was an RJ, all of them used to have a prefix to their names. This was when they decided that the word kirik works well with my name. The show I did was such where I’d call people and prank them. Then, when I moved to a news channel, they asked me to retain that prankster image and do a show titled Mr Kirik. Following this, I then had a show called Kirik With Keerthi. Once I quit media, I started a page with the Kirik Keerthi name and that’s how it began. The kirik is not because of anything else; the kirik I do is only for good things and causes. VietNamNet Bridge – High-ranking General Vo Nguyen Giap is a legendary general of Vietnamese people and international friends. The country is about to celebrate Mr. Giap’s 100th birthday, which will fall on August 25. On this occasion, Colonel Nguyen Huyen, who has been working for the general for nearly 40 years, including 20 years in charge of the general’s office, told reporters about the current situation of the legendary general.You have just visited the general at the Army Hospital 108. Could you tell us the recent health situation of the general? I visit the general three or four times a week. His health is stable now. He is of sound mind but we still need to conserve his health so visits are restricted. Today I asked him “Do you feel painful?”, he shook his head. Several days ago, when I asked him that question, he pointed his finger to his stomach. When I came, he shook my hand and when I left, he held my hand tightly.
